Allos Therapeutics, Inc. (Nasdaq:ALTH) announced the pricing of an underwritten public offering of 10,800,000 shares of newly issued common stock at a public offering price of $5.64 per share. The closing of the offering is expected to take place on May 29, 2008, subject to the satisfaction of customary closing conditions. The Company has granted the underwriters a 30-day option to purchase an additional 1,620,000 shares of common stock from the Company to cover overallotments, if any. The Company expects to receive net proceeds from the offering of approximately $56.6 million, after deducting underwriting commissions and estimated offering expenses. The Company plans to use the net proceeds from the financing primarily for clinical and preclinical research and development of its product candidates, manufacture of clinical trial material and pre-commercial scale-up activities for PDX, working capital and general corporate purposes. Merrill Lynch & Co. is acting as sole bookrunner for this offering. Banc of America Securities LLC and Citigroup Global Markets Inc. are acting as co-lead managers. About Allos Therapeutics, Inc. Allos Therapeutics is a biopharmaceutical company focused on developing and commercializing small molecule therapeutics for the treatment of cancer.�The Company's lead product candidate, PDX (pralatrexate), is a novel antifolate currently under evaluation in a pivotal Phase 2 (PROPEL) trial in patients with relapsed or refractory peripheral T-cell lymphoma. The PROPEL trial is being conducted under an agreement reached with the U.S. Food and Drug Administration under its special protocol assessment, or SPA, process. The Company is also investigating PDX in patients with non-small cell lung cancer and a range of lymphoma sub-types. The Company's other product candidate�is RH1, a targeted chemotherapeutic agent currently being evaluated in a Phase 1 trial in patients with advanced solid tumors or non-Hodgkin�s lymphoma (NHL).
